After getting over its initial shock, the slime immediately dove inward. And to its surprise, it was immensely stronger. Now, it was time to check out its new stuff! Just as it was about to find out what all its boosts had done, and especially about what Increased Potential was all about, the slime picked up something on the edge of its perception: the sound of footsteps. If it could have spoken, it might have made a surprised sound. But as it was, it hastily unwrapped itself from the now long dead rat and hurried down this branch of the cave it was in.
It sensed the end ahead. There were no more monsters here, other than itself, but that wouldn’t resolve its conundrum. Now was the time to locate somewhere to hide, and where better to do that than behind the only thing that isn’t smooth stone? It’s slightly boosted agility allowed the newly enterprising monster to quickly cover the distance from its former spot on the floor to a small box-like object. It was about half a meter in size, which would be just big enough to hide behind. It seems that this was a lucky day for the slime, because the dungeon decided to place a Treasure Chest down this path.
The slime was just sliding into place behind the box when it remembered the rat corpse that it had left behind. It couldn’t remember what exactly happened to corpses like this one, since it never survived long enough before to figure that out, but it was going to trust that the Dungeon had its own kind of recycling system. And so, hoping for help from this new attribute of Luck, the monster focused on staying as hidden as possible. And just in time, too. For not a minute later, the voices of the adventurers were finally close enough for its perception to pick up.
“... I mean, it’s just weird. This new slime has been appearing in the same place of this dungeon for the last few weeks, and now it’s not there.”
“Alright, I’ll give you that. So maybe the Newb Dungeon just had an event happening? I heard from my cousin that they can do that sometimes.”
“If that’s the case, I knew we should have tried to visit this place before now. Everyone has been going on about this ‘rare monster’ for a while now. It was supposed to boost you by a level at least. And that was with six in the Party!”
“This is such a huge loss…”
The slime, being tone-deaf due to its limited perception, couldn’t tell if there were two or more in the group, but they seemed to be looking for it specifically. That just made the slime attempt to condense itself as much as possible behind this chest.
--- Would you like to activate your stealth skill? Yes or No?
Yes! Of course, yes! The slime immediately responded, putting its absolute all into the mental selection.
--- Stealth has been activated.
Even though it felt relieved, the slime did not allow itself to relax, focusing so intently on hiding that it did not notice anything else being said by the adventurers. It did, however, notice when they entered into its perception area. There were four of them.
Advertisement
They seemed to be approaching with caution, stopping only four meters away. It seemed as if they were considering something for a moment, then they let their guards down. One of them, maybe the leader of the group, approached the chest and haphazardly threw it open, only to sigh at the lack of anything useful. They still took it with them, turning around to show it to the rest of the group. This presented an intriguing opportunity. Should it attack the adventurers, maybe getting the drop on them and taking down the one with his back to the slime? On one hand, it seemed like there was something almost encouraging to the idea; however, it resisted the urge and remained hidden.
After what felt like an eternity later, the party continued on their way. They had briefly discussed how odd it was to run into not only one, but two tunnels empty of Monsters. They laughed for a moment as one of them pondered aloud about if the Boss door was already open and the Boss itself lay dead on the floor. The laughter almost seemed to be forced, and quickly died away.
The slime only allowed itself to relax a full minute after they left. And was greeted with another notification.
--- Congratulations! Your Stealth skill has improved from Inept to Untrained. The Attribute, Physical - Finesse, has been created and has increased to 1. Finesse +2, Agility +1.
Well, that should help if it ever wants to sneak up on anything ever again. Which, to be fair, it probably would. And who knows, maybe someday, the slime will be the one to get the drop on these homewrecking thieves! It realized after a moment that the raiders never mentioned anything about a rat lying dead somewhere… or maybe the monster was so caught up in not being seen and consequently killed, that it missed any comments they may have made on the subject. In order to confirm that it wasn’t completely inept at survival, it slowly, and quietly, made its way back towards where the rat corpse should have been only a few moments ago.
About three meters away from the chest, the former hiding spot vanished, leaving behind empty air. The slime paused for a moment. That was odd… but maybe that’s normal? Having never really survived long enough to notice what happened to any boxes the monster had previously spawned near, it wasn’t entirely sure of that answer… Maybe tonight, after the adventurers stop visiting for the day, it could find out? But then again… Monsters don’t spawn during the evening. Would treasure chests be the same? Maybe one day, the slime would be able to clear out its own dungeon before any adventurers would arrive? Putting its hopes and dreams off to one side of its mind for the time being, the slime continued to investigate the rat corpse that, it surmised, would no longer be there.
And sure enough, the slime reached the end of the passage with no rat-like mound lying upon the ground. This ignited a desire within the slime to find out what exactly would happen to these creatures, and in turn itself, after they were slain, but that would have to wait until the next time. Or maybe even the time after that. After all, the monster’s third step in its four-step plan still remained incomplete. It still needed to safely hide until the adventurers were gone. And so, thinking that it would be able to find a new corner to make itself unnoticeable once more, the slime turned to its left at the main passage, heading further into the dungeon, and most likely following after the party that had just looted its prior hiding spot from existence…
Advertisement
The slime slowly approached the end of the main passage in the Dungeon of Newb. The passageway quickly spread out further than its senses could pick up, so it stayed to the right wall. This entire time, it had kept its stealth up, but upon checking its stats, the skill had not moved from its current point since the group had left it behind. Erring on the side of caution, the monster kept crawling forward at a pace that most crawling toddlers should be able to surpass with ease. By the time it was going around to where the passage opened up, the slime was feeling a small sense of accomplishment.
Judging from the vibrations at the end of its senses, the adventuring Party had already begun to fight with the Boss. Though the slime had never seen the Boss personally, it imagined that the group would be occupied for at least another few minutes. With that in mind, it kept moving along the edge of the cave.
Eventually, the slime found what looked to be an oddly sharp corner. It didn’t know exactly why the cave wall looked like this, but the wall on the left side was surprisingly thin. In reality, this was the wide open Boss Room door, though the slime did not have enough evidence, nor common sense, to deduce such a fact. It did, however, notice that there was an opening on the other side of the “thin wall” (door), and that there was a similarly wedge-shaped wall across the way (the other door). To this monster, this oddity of a crevice would be just the place to hide until those pesky monster hunters left. Said monster felt that it had survived much longer this respawn than all its previous respawns combined due to its own wit and desire to survive.
By the time that it had placed itself behind the door, still leaving its Stealth active, the fight with the Boss was over, and the “heroes” were crying out in victory. Well, maybe that was a bit too enthusiastic. They were just glad to be done with it, and able to move on to better and more dangerous prey. The slime waited, making itself as condensed as possible. Maybe it was trying to imitate a stone. Not that it had seen any as big as it was, but it was still hoping to not be noticed. And it didn’t have to wait long for those bandits to make their way out the opening. From its current vantage point, it had no way to know exactly where they were. The monster was able to surmise that they were getting closer to its location, then moving further away, if the sounds were anything to go by.
A few seconds passed as the door closed all by itself, exposing the slime to the open room once more. Sitting as still as the stones it was trying to imitate, the slime tried to just “act natural”. If slimes could sweat, then this one would certainly be doing so by the bucketload. The sounds of footsteps on the stone surface slowly faded away. The slime was not spotted. Only after several minutes of nothing disturbing its senses did it finally relax into a puddle on the ground. That was too close, it thought, thanking its lucky slimes that it was able to pull off the most daring plan it had ever come up with. Granted, this may have been the only thing it had ever tried resembling an actual plan, but it had worked thus far. And in order for it to continue to work, it needed to be ready for anything. And to actually be ready, it would need to know what it was currently capable of. And so, it pulled up its Stats once more.
